Convention at Phoenix Decide Route Government Help Build

Delegates from San Bernardino County Riverside and Victorville Barstow Ludlow Oro Grande and Ludlow will travel to Phoenix aboard the Santa Fe Friday to attend the U S Highway Commission meeting April 24 to 29. They aim to win government aid for the National Old Trail route through Barstow, with rival routes under review at Yuma Blythe and Parker, affecting desert towns and tourist travel.

Ludlow Town Shows Desert Hospitality For Auto Tourists

Ludlow, an oasis 55 miles east of Barstow, attracts travelers with clean streets, painted buildings, and irrigation water hauled 30 miles. Murphy Bros. run a large general store, hotel, garage, and pool hall, while A I Addy, Mrs. Reed, and other locals operate eateries, lodging, and a growing Oasis complex with free camp grounds and plans for a rest room and more amenities. The town prepares for the summer tourist trade with flowers, vines, and a Stradivara phonograph for entertainment.

Improvements At Barstow Postoffice Benefit Patrons

Barstow postoffice upgrades under new administration enhance mail handling for staff and customers. 132 lock boxes added with 90 rented. parcel post window installed. general delivery boxes rearranged for direct access. registry and money order window positioned for privacy. Plan to install a new floor and steel lattice work to allow front door to stay unlocked for around the clock mail retrieval.

Storms across the central states kill dozens and injure many

Terrific storms sweeping eastward across the country produced tornadoes in parts of the central states, killing at least 32 people, leaving two missing and about 320 injured. Property damage runs into millions of dollars, based on reports from affected areas.

Town plants trees as railroad ships ore to town

Eucalyptus umbrellas cotton wood and fig trees line the town while Standard Oil Co plants shrubbery to beautify. Tonopah and Tidewater railroad brings large lead and silver shipments from Noonday mine at Tecopa. Pacific mines reportedly to reopen, promising more Ludlow business.
